Ultrasound Technician Work Summary<\/strong><\/h3>\n

\"RamerThere are several professional titles for ultrasound techs (technicians). They are also referred to as sonogram techs, diagnostic medical sonographers (or just sonographers) and ultrasound technologists. Regardless of name, they all have the same basic job description, which is to carry out diagnostic ultrasound testing on patients. Although many work as generalists there are specializations within the field, for instance in cardiology and pediatrics.
